Job Description and Responsibilities
The NASA-KSC Artemis Program Advanced Planning Analyst and Data Science position requires fundamental understanding Industrial Engineering and Operations Research with proven experience in developing analytical models, performing quantitative and objective analyses, and using the latest Computer Off-The Shelf (COTS) data science, analytics, and data visualization tools, (e.g., Tableau, power BI) to collect, integrate, and report meaningful metrics from a variety of data sources.
This position entails providing quantitative analysis, metrics and insights that will help drive operational efficiencies during Artemis flight hardware processing and will be used to inform critical NASA Program decisions. The candidate must be able to understand current NASA data repositories and structures to assist in defining future data products for evaluating contract performance.
Expectations
· Familiarity with launch vehicle commodity usage, launch probability assessment, firing room asset acquisition priorities, schedule performance to plan analysis, battery lab analysis, etc. is preferred to support programmatic data-driven decisions.
· Understanding of schedule risk development and management preferred.
· Understanding of program level requirements documents preferred.
Minimum Requirements
· 10 years’ experience of related experience and an advanced Master’s degree. Preferably experience in launch vehicle, facility, payloads, transportation, test integration, and operations.
· Knowledge of ground support equipment utilized for flight hardware lifting, servicing, integration, and operations.
· Knowledge of Concept of Operations development, integration, and implementation.
· Proficiency in technical document review to include design drawings.
· Self-starter with outstanding organizational, analytical, and problem-solving skills.
· Effective and clear communicator with the ability to present technical issues.
· Excellent interpersonal skills with the ability to work in a team environment co-located with multiple cross program customers and contractors.
· Flexible to changing work demands, multi-task, operate with minimal direct supervision, and meet all customer deadlines.
· Proven work (mid-level) as a cohesive team member with many different technical experts in a dynamic schedule-driven environment.
· Proficiency in Microsoft Office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Project and Outlook, as well as commercial business applications.
Education and Relevant Work Experience
This position requires a MS in Engineering with very strong Industrial Engineering or Operations Research experience and 10 years of relevant work experience.
